For organizations adopting a microservices-based architecture, automated orchestration engines like Kubernetes have their limitations.
While they’re terrific for coordinating, maintaining and scaling microservice instances, they’re not so great for Zero Trust security, RBAC, network security or even standardization of platform services like service discovery and load balancing.
Service meshes solve these problems, but they can be intimidating to the beginner.
